How to Renew Philippine Passport in Israel

Filipinos can renew the passport at the Philippine Embassy in Tel Aviv, Israel from Sunday to Thursday (9:30 am – 4:30 pm). Personal appearance of the applicant is required.

Step 1: Go to the Embassy and bring the complete requirements.

  1. Accomplished e-Passport application form
  2. Original Philippine passport
  3. Photocopy of the passport’s data page
  4. Fee: $60 or NIS equivalent based on current Embassy rates

Check the additional requirements for married women, dual citizens, minor, first-time applicants, and those who have lost their passport.

Step 2: Check on Facebook if your passport is ready for release.

Step 3: Claim the e-Passport at the Philippine Embassy in Israel and bring the requirements depending on who will get the passport.

Passport Claim by Applicant

  1. Official receipt
  2. Old passport for cancellation

Passport Claim by Authorized Person

  1. Official receipt
  2. Old passport for cancellation
  3. Authorization letter from the passport applicant
  4. Identification card or passport of the authorized representative
